iSHIFT is Sanofi's strategic enterprise transformation program, deploying SAP S/4HANA (including MDG – Master Data Governance) across the global organization. It is the backbone of Sanofi's CORE model, standardizing and harmonizing processes across Finance, Supply Chain, Manufacturing, and beyond. Through a "shift left" approach and SAP MVP delivery methodology, iSHIFT is accelerating rollouts across regions and countries — reducing project lifecycle by up to 50% while ensuring quality and adoption.
The iSHIFT program mobilizes cross-functional teams across Digital, Finance, M&S, Business Operations, BPOs, and external partners to deliver a unified, future-ready ERP platform for Sanofi worldwide.

As the iSHIFT SCI Solution Delivery SCI TM/IM Lead, you will be the functional and technical owner of the Supply Chain Integration (SCI) workstream, with a specific focus on SAP Transportation Management (TM) and Inventory Management (IM) modules. You will drive end-to-end solution design, delivery, and continuous improvement of TM/IM capabilities within the iSHIFT program, ensuring alignment with Sanofi's global CORE model.
Sitting within the Digital Delivery & Operations / iSHIFT Enablement team, you will work in close collaboration with iSHIFT program leaders, Supply Chain BPOs, the Supply Chain Coalition, and key iSHIFT stakeholders.
This is a high-impact, highly visible role at the intersection of supply chain operations and digital transformation — for someone who thrives in complex, global, fast-paced environments and is passionate about delivering solutions that matter.
Key Responsibilities
Solution Design & Delivery
Lead the end-to-end design, configuration, and delivery of SAP TM and IM solutions within the iSHIFT program, ensuring alignment with Sanofi's global CORE model
- Translate business requirements from Supply Chain BPOs and process owners into robust, scalable SAP TM/IM functional specifications
- Drive solution architecture decisions for transportation planning, freight order management, inventory movements, goods receipt/issue, and stock management processes
- Ensure integration consistency between TM/IM and adjacent modules (EM, P2R, ICO, EWM, MM, SD, FI/CO) within the S/4HANA landscape
TM/IM Module Ownership
- Act as the functional owner of SAP TM and IM modules within the iSHIFT program, maintaining deep expertise in configuration, process flows, and best practices
- Define and govern the TM/IM CORE model, ensuring standardization and harmonization across all rollout countries and regions
- Manage the TM/IM solution backlog, prioritizing enhancements and fixes in collaboration with BPOs and Digital teams
- Oversee master data requirements related to TM/IM
Rollout & Go-Live Support
- Lead TM/IM solution delivery activities across multi-country iSHIFT rollouts, from blueprint through go-live
- Apply the iSHIFT methodology — driving CORE model adoption and country preparation to accelerate deployment timelines
- Coordinate fit-gap analysis, solution demos, and MVP showcases for new countries and regions
- Manage go-live readiness activities including cutover planning, data migration validation, and user acceptance testing (UAT) for TM/IM scope
- Provide hands-on hypercare support during and after go-live, ensuring business continuity and rapid issue resolution
Stakeholder Management
- Build and maintain strong relationships with Supply Chain BPOs, process owners, country teams, Finance, M&S, and Business Operations stakeholders
- Collaborate closely with the Supply Chain Coalition and iSHIFT program leadership to align on priorities, timelines, and delivery commitments
- Engage with external system integrators and implementation partners, ensuring quality delivery and adherence to Sanofi standards
- Communicate solution design decisions, risks, and Progress clearly to both technical and business audiences at all levels
Core Model Governance
- Ensure TM/IM process designs adhere to iSHIFT CORE model principles, preventing unnecessary customizations and protecting solution integrity
- Participate in CORE model governance forums, contributing to design decisions and change control processes
- Document and maintain TM/IM solution design artifacts, functional specifications, and process documentation
- Champion standardization and harmonization across all iSHIFT deployments, balancing global consistency with local statutory requirements
Hypercare & AMS Support
- Define and oversee the transition from project delivery to Application Management Services (AMS) for TM/IM scope
- Establish SLA frameworks and support models for post-go-live TM/IM operations
- Collaborate with AMS teams to ensure knowledge transfer, runbook documentation, and incident resolution capabilities are in place
- Monitor post-go-live KPIs and drive continuous improvement initiatives to optimize TM/IM solution performance
Team Leadership
- Lead and mentor a team of SAP TM/IM functional consultants and analysts across the iSHIFT program
- Foster a collaborative, high-performance team culture aligned with Sanofi's values
- Coordinate with workstream leads across SCI (and other iSHIFT streams) to ensure end-to-end process coherence
- Support capability building within the team, promoting knowledge sharing and professional development
